iQOO, a sub-brand of Vivo, is set to launch its new iQOO Neo 8 series smartphones. The lineup will consist of two devices – the iQOO 8 and the iQOO Neo 8 Pro. Both devices are expected to launch in China soon, and rumors about their specifications are already circulating.
Recently, the iQOO Neo 8 Pro was spotted in China’s 3C certification, along with Vivo’s upcoming S17 series smartphone, the Vivo S17e. Let’s take a closer look at what these new devices have to offer.
iQOO Neo 8 Pro: 120W Fast Charging Support and Dimensity 9200+ SoC
According to the 3C certification listing, the iQOO Neo 8 Pro (V2302A) will support 120W fast charging, which is a significant improvement over the previous model’s 66W fast charging. The device will also come with 5G connectivity support.
Under the hood, the device is expected to come with an octa-core Dimensity 9200+ SoC, which is MediaTek’s latest flagship processor. The device may also feature up to 16GB of RAM and 512GB of internal storage.
The iQOO Neo 8 Pro is also expected to feature an AMOLED display, which may offer Full HD+ resolution. The device may have a 50MP primary camera, and it is rumored to run on Android 13 OS out of the box.
Vivo S17e: 80W Fast Charging Support and 5G Connectivity
The Vivo S17e (V2285A) has also received 3C certification, and it will come with 80W fast charging support, which is an improvement over its predecessor’s 65W fast charging. Like the iQOO Neo 8 Pro, the Vivo S17e will also have 5G connectivity support. However, the specifications of the Vivo S17e are not yet known, and we will have to wait for further information.
iQOO Neo 8: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1 SoC and 120Hz Refresh Rate
The vanilla iQOO Neo 8 (V2301A) was also spotted in 3C certification, and it will support up to 120W fast charging. It will feature a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1 SoC and may come with up to 16GB of RAM and 512GB of internal storage. The device may also have a 50MP primary camera, and it is expected to feature a 6.67-inch display with a 120Hz refresh rate.
